Abstract
Tunable filters have been proposed and demonstrated. It is seen that a Thue-Morse aperiod structure composed of single-negative materials can act as a tunable filter, which is insensitive to the incident angle and polarization of light, and is an omnidirectional filter, and the bandwidth and frequency of the filter can be changed by adjusting the layer thicknesses and plasma frequency, respectively.
